Mold Remediation Without the Demolition
Pure Maintenance's patented two-step VaPURE™ process delivers our sterilant at microscopic particle size throughout the property, reaching virtually every hard non-porous surface — including the ones traditional methods can't access without demolition. We help homeowners and businesses across Northern California understand and address mold in their property using Pure Maintenance's patented VaPURE™ process.
Our patented VaPURE™ process carries a sterilant throughout the property reaching virtually every hard non-porous surface — including those traditional spraying and wiping can't access. Following remediation, an antimicrobial coating is applied to inhibit the growth of mold and mildew on treated surfaces.

We can help you understand if you have mold, why you have it and how severe the issue is with our testing & inspection options. The testing and inspections we offer can help us tailor our mold remediation treatment to the unique circumstances in your home or business, or simply help you answer questions.

Our VaPURE™ mold remediation process involves the application of an antimicrobial protectant, which inhibits the growth of mold and mildew.
